This book provides a comprehensive overview of non-surgical treatments for complicated and refractory biliary and pancreatic lesions. In particular, it offers non-surgical treatment options for benign biliary strictures. For those suffering from intractable total biliary obstruction following biliary operation, magnetic compression anastomosis represents a good therapeutic option, and this technique is fully explained. Moreover, the book describes diverse treatment modalities for hilar stricture, which is one of the most challenging areas of ERCP. Several chapters cover a variety of important aspects of this area. The book also aims to identify and solve the unmet needs for the diagnosis and treatment of biliary and pancreatic diseases. The precise explanations of treatment concepts and strategies will both increase readers’ knowledge and provide assistance in daily clinical practice. The authors are pioneering experts from around the world, and the text is supported by numerous informative illustrations and helpful summaries.
